Maksym Kozub Many years ago, I got quite disappointed when seeing that my country is still very far from the real rule of law, and left my career as a lawyer. However, law has always remained of great interest to me in my translation and interpreting work.

I have done a lot of written legal and corporate translations, including both Ukrainian and foreign laws, companies' articles of association, a thesis in comparative law, etc.

In addition to translating legal stuff and working as an interpreter in legal settings, I often use my legal skills when working for various sorts of clients. For example, World Bank Country Office in Ukraine had a special mission with a focus on Ukrainian mortgage legislation, which I assisted as an interpreter.

Among the long-term projects for which I worked, there has been "Institutional Reforms and Informal Sector", a USAID-funded project back in 1999. Its core activities included participation of US lawyers in the development of the registration system for property titles and pledges in Ukraine, in cooperation with Ukrainian lawyers, parliament members, Ministry of Justice officials, etc. Working as a translator/interpreter for this project, like in many other cases, I had to use my knowledge of both Ukrainian and international law to help people understand the differences between the legal systems, etc.

More recent experience includes e.g. simultaneous interpreting at the series of seminars held for Ukrainian barristers and judges by the American Bar Association / Central European and Eurasian Law Initiative (June 2005). The panel included Justice A. Kharchenko (Supreme Court of Ukraine), Judge T. Griffith (United States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it), and Judge E. Ludlow (5th District Court, State of Utah). This assignment was arranged by my good colleagues, Serhiy Syzenko and Serhiy Kolesnyk, who are always a pleasure to work with (and performed with the latter).
